It supports encrypted connections via SSL and SSH to PostgreSQL 8.0 and later, including Amazon Redshift. Postico is a fully native Mac app for connecting to your PostgreSQL server. A free "demo" version of an inexpensive proprietary app, but it has very reasonable limits ("only one tab") and no time limit.
